Canadian Academy of Health Sciences inducts six UBC faculty

Congratulations to all six UBC faculty members announced as Fellows of the Canadian Academy of Health Sciences. Election to fellowship in the CAHS represents one of the highest honours for members of the Canadian health sciences community. The demonstrated leadership and distinctive competencies of these individuals have led to remarkable accomplishments and advancements in academic health sciences in Canada.

The UBC faculty CAHS inductees include:

Karen Gelmon, a Professor of Medical Oncology at the BC Cancer Agency and the University of British Columbia.

Dermot Kelleher, Vice President, Health at UBC and Dean of the Faculty of Medicine, an accomplished academic leader with an international reputation.

Timothy Kieffer, a Professor in the Faculty of Medicine at the University of British Columbia and leader of the Life Sciences Institute Diabetes Research Group.

Larry Lynd, an Associate Member of the School of Population and Public Health. A pharmacist and epidemiologist, he is the Director of the UBC Collaboration for Outcomes Research and Evaluation, an internationally recognized research group.

Heather McKay, a health scientist who applies health promotion science in the public health domain by conducting trials that span randomized controlled intervention trials to pragmatic, flexible dissemination trials (implementation at scale evaluation).

Yuzhuo Wang, a Professor in the Department of Urologic Sciences and senior research scientist at the Vancouver Prostate Centre.
